Jeb Dunnuck: 91-93 Points
From vines just beside Fleur Cardinale (the estate acquired this 4.5-hectare parcel in 2012), the 2018 Château Croix Cardinale reveals a deep purple color as well as medium to full-bodied notes of spiced plums, graphite, licorice, and earth. It’s a ripe, sexy wine that has plenty of sweet tannins, a great texture, and plenty of length on the finish, and it’s very much in the style of the ripe yet pure vintage. The blend is 75% Merlot and 25% Cabernet Franc, brought up in new French oak.
Wine Advocate: 90-92 Points
Dominique and Florence Decoster, owners of Fleur Cardinale, acquired this 4.5-hectare vineyard in Saint-Étienne-de-Lisse adjacent to their own in April 2012. Not surprisingly, the soils are quite similar, composed of clay and limestone. The average age of the vines was 37 years in 2018. Yields were 40 hectoliters per hectare. Aging is projected to run for 12-14 months in 100% new French oak barrels. The blend is 75% Merlot and 25% Cabernet Franc, and the wine has 14.5% alcohol. From the Thibaud lieu-dit, the 2018 Croix Cardinale is deep garnet-purple colored and sings of crushed red and black cherries, wild blueberries and fragrant earth with wafts of garrigue and lavender. Medium to full-bodied, soft, lively and juicy in the mouth, it delivers great purity and poise.
